Episode 133: Charles Darwin at Down House Part 1 - Outside looking in


Listen Later

Darren Weale and Sarah Marsh-Collings visit the former home of Charles Darwin in Bromley, Down House

This episode is recorded outside the home with Tessa Kilgariff, Collections Curator for South London for English Heritage, and Antony O'Rourke, Head Gardener.

The conversation ranges across their roles and backgrounds, an introduction to Charles Darwin and Down House, Darwin's wife, Emma, and the greenhouses, orchids,  carnivorous and sensitive plants.

Down House is open to the public.
